返回列表 发帖

大家好,我来晚了,请多多关照,超级菜的近来看

[这个贴子最后由woxiaocang在 2005/05/26 08:03pm 第 3 次编辑]

各位大虾,小弟刚来,不懂规矩,就发篇菜鸟看的帖子吧.希望对那些处于蒙昧状态的小鸟有些帮助. :em14: 下面是三个最简单一稍复杂的C程序,仔细阅读程序并领会各程序的运行结果,以熟悉C程序的基本结构和Turbo C的基本操作流程。
1、 main()
{
printf(“欢迎进入C语言的世界!”) ;
}
说明:
一个C程序中必须有且只能有一个以main为名的函数,即主函数。上面的程序里只有一个函数,这个函数当然就是主函数了。
2、 main()
   {
   int a,b,sum;      /*  定义a、b、sum三个变量为int类型    */
   a=1;
     b=2;
     sum=a+b;        /*   将a与b之和赋值给sum    */
     clrscr();
     printf(“sum=%d”,sum);
     }
说明:
   这个练习中用到了变量(a、b 和sum ).C语言规定,变量使用之前必须先作定义.因此,如果没有语句“ int a,b,sum;”,那么编译时会在Message窗口中显示出如下信息:

  3、main()
     {
     int a,b;
     a=2;
     b=pf(a);     /*   调用pf()函数,并将函数的返回值典型值变量b*/
     clrscr();
     printf(“a=%d,b=%d”,a,b);   /*   输出a和b 的值   */
     }
     pf(num)     /*   定义pf()函数   */
     int num;    /*    定义形式参数num   */
     {
     int t;
     t=num*num;  /*  将num的平方赋值给变量t  */
     return(t);    /*   返回变量t的值   */
    }
(1) 程序中的注释是为了帮助你理解程序,录入程序时可以免去注释部分,发提高建立程序的效率.运行程序后仔细分析运行结果。
(2) 将程序中的main() 函数改写如下:
main()
{
int a,b;
clrscr();
scanf(“%d”,&a);   /*  输入一个整数到变量a中   */
b=pf(a);
prinf(“a=%d,b=%d”,a,b);  /*  输出a和b的值    */
}
再运行程序,当从键盘输入2时,输出:
a=2,b=4
       从键盘输入5时,输出:
a=5,b=25
    说明:
函数是构成c程序的基本单位,一个C程序中除了main函数之外还可以有若干个其他的函数,每个函数实现一种特定的功能(如函数pf()的功能是对一个整数求平方,并返回平方值).注意在书写上main函数可以写在其他函数的定义之前,也可以写在其他函数的定义之后,但程序的执行总是从main函数开始。

大家好,我来晚了,请多多关照,超级菜的近来看

书上都写着的,不过精神可嘉!

TOP

大家好,我来晚了,请多多关照,超级菜的近来看

呵呵~
建议先看看每版的帖。

TOP

返回列表 回复 发帖